Al Khums Climate

Al Khums has an average annual temperature of 20.5°C (69°F) and receives about 280 mm of precipitation per year. The warmest month is August and the coldest is January. Figures are 1970–2000 climate normals.

Al Khums — monthly temperature & precipitation (1970–2000 normals) · Source: WorldClim 2.1
MonthAvg (°C/°F)Precip
January14° / 56°55 mm
February14° / 57°32 mm
March16° / 61°26 mm
April18° / 64°10 mm
May21° / 70°5 mm
June25° / 76°1 mm
July27° / 80°0 mm
August28° / 82°0 mm
September26° / 80°10 mm
October24° / 74°42 mm
November19° / 66°42 mm
December15° / 59°57 mm

1970–2000 normals from WorldClim 2.1 (~9 km grid). Precipitation can be less precise near mountains or coastlines, where rainfall varies sharply over short distances.

Best time to visit Al Khums

The most comfortable months to visit Al Khums are typically May, April and June, when temperatures are mildest and rainfall is relatively low. The hottest month is August (around 32°C high). The coldest is January (near 10°C low). December is usually the wettest month.
